Which is fine. It depends how much time you are prepared to spend keeping it up to scratch. If you don't mind waxing it once a week / 2 weeks, P21S it is. If not, Collinite or jetSEAL are others to consider. Then you will need a carnuba top up to keep the shine.
Any pics of the swirl marks? Depending how bad, it may need a Makita / Porter Cable with some compounds to get them out. If is is surface swirls, then it may be possible to improve them by hand. Best way to get the pics is when it is darker with a bright light reflecting in the surface.
